The Six of Cups is a gentle card that represents nostalgia, basking in childhood memories and joy and innocence.
The memories you fondly remember do not have to be from your childhood.
It can be from when you were a teenager to when you were a younger adult, especially during simpler times.
Let's go over the appearance and history of this card.
The History And Appearance Of The Six of Cups
The Six of Cups first appeared in a deck of tarot cards known as the Visconti-Sforza tarot deck.
This deck was created in the 15th century for Duke Francesco Sforza and his wife, Bianca Maria Visconti.
The Six of Cups is believed to represent their six children.
The Six of Cups has changed over the years, but the card's meaning has remained the same.
This card is still associated with happiness, nostalgia, and innocence.
It is a reminder to cherish the good times and the people who have been a part of our lives.
When you look at this card from the Rider-Waite-Smith deck, you will see a young boy leaning down.
He is passing over a cup with flowers to a little girl, and she looks at him with respect and admiration.
The kids represent childhood memories and innocence, and you see an older gentleman walking in the background.
The vibe you get from that is that he says you no longer have to worry about adult issues.
You also see the kids standing in a courtyard of a home that looks like an estate home representing security and safety.

What It Means To Get The Six of Cups In A Reading
The Six of Cups is generally associated with nostalgia and looking back on happy memories.
It can represent a time when things were simpler and more innocent.
This card can also suggest that you take a break from your current situation and focus on what's important to you.
The Six of Cups suggest that things are going well if you're currently in a relationship.
You and your partner will likely have a strong connection and share many happy memories.
However, this card can also indicate that you may be longing for a time when things were simpler.
If you're feeling this way, it's essential to communicate with your partner and ensure you're both on the same page.
If you're single, the Six of Cups can indicate that you're ready to find love.
This is an excellent time to put yourself out there and meet new people.
You may find yourself attracted to someone who reminds you of a past love.
However, it's important to stay open-minded and remember that not every relationship has to be perfect.
When this card comes up, something from your past emerges in your life.
For example, it could signify that a childhood friend will suddenly appear in your life.
Perhaps you have been invited to a high school reunion (not me, no way, as I hated high school).
Whether the memories from high school were happy depends on the other cards in the spread.
But it is something from your past that is coming into your life.
Usually, this card represents happy memories from the past unless it is reversed.
You may also come across an item that you had as a child packed away, which will bring back memories.
As you may go through your old things in a box.
Sometimes when this card comes up, it indicates that you need to do inner child work.
But, once again, that depends on the spread.
